Listen for unusual noises like grinding or squealing. If the door moves unevenly or gets stuck, it needs attention. Visible damage to panels or tracks is also a sign. We can assess the issue.
Extreme temperatures, both hot and cold, can stress garage door components. Sudden changes can cause materials to expand or contract. This is common in North Carolina. We are ready for these issues.
